The 6th edition of —most notably the versions by Kenneth H. Rosen and Richard Johnsonbaugh —remains a cornerstone in computer science and mathematics curricula for its rigorous yet accessible approach to non-continuous structures. : The Johnsonbaugh 6th edition is specifically recognized for its algorithmic approach , including over 500 worked examples and 3,500 exercises to build technical intuition.
